Revenue and income statement
In 2024, PAUL BRONDEX ET FILS achieves revenue of 6.4 M€. Revenue is growing positively over 9 years (CAGR: +1.1%). Slight decline of -7% vs 2023. After deducting consumption (1.9 M€), gross margin stands at 4.5 M€, i.e. a rate of 71%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 356 k€, representing 5.5% of revenue. Warning negative scissor effect: despite revenue change (-7%), EBITDA varies by -33%, reducing margin by 2.1 pts. This reflects costs rising faster than revenue. The operating margin remains fragile, requiring cost vigilance.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 152 k€, i.e. 2.4%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 28%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 54%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 4.1 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This ratio remains within usual banking standards. Cash flow represents 2.9%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 152 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 59 days. The gap of 93 days means the company finances its customers for over a month before being paid relative to supplier payments. This weighs on cash flow. Inventory turnover is 61 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Overall, WCR represents 182 days of revenue, i.e. 3.2 M€ to permanently finance.

How is this estimate calculated?
This estimate is based on the analysis of 51 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.
E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.
This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
